Been looking for a cheap starter vehicle for my 17 year old daughter and all I find online in my area is junk but I came across this ad http://www.kijiji.ca/v-cars-trucks/lethbridge/blue-ford-escape/594910291?enableSearchNavigationFlag=true so I emailed the guy last night and asked him if it was still available and apparently has a torque converter issue. He replied back to me saying that if I have it out if his place by Wednesday night I can have it for $200. Is it worth it? Anyone have experience with this vehicle and possibly this particular issue? Is it a big job? I've pulled torque converters from earlier 80's vehicles but never on something newer like this. Opinions anyone?

for 200  go for it  you can get that @ scrapyard

 

other is  faulty OD switch or speedo sensor

 

hows the fluid ...... color and is it gritty  then lock-up clutch is gone  replace torque converter

 

other is fuel injectors if high km's
